WebFlow cytometry (FC) is a technique used to detect and measure physical and chemical characteristics of a population of cells or particles.. In this process, a sample containing cells or particles is suspended in a fluid and injected into the flow cytometer instrument. WebIntracellular Cytokine Staining. Intracellular cytokine staining is a versatile technique used to analyze cytokine production in individual cells by flow cytometry. The recipient cells are analyzed ex vivo after isolation from the peripheral blood following either nonspecific stimulation or donor-specific stimulation. It allows you to see populations with the combinations of parameters that you define using Boolean logic. Plots visually display the data. Histograms (single parameter plots) and 2-parameter dot plots are the most commonly used types of plots.
